Temple University Graduate Student Diversity

8,183 Graduate Students
60.7% Women
36.7% Racial-Ethnic Minorities*

Temple University was the school of choice for 8,183 graduate students in the last year for which we have data.Since diversity is such an important part of the grad school experience, College Factual looked deeper at the demographics of these students.Our findings are below.

Temple Graduate Student Male-Female Ratio

The total graduate student population at Temple is made up of 60.7% women and 39.3% men. Note that these percentages may differ for certain degree programs. Male-to-Female Ratio of Temple University Graduate Students

Temple Graduate Student Racial-Ethnic Diversity

About 36.7% of the graduate students who attend Temple are from a racial-ethnic minority group*.The school attracts students from outside the U.S., too. Around 13.2% of graduate students hail from another country.The following chart shows the distribution of racial-ethnic groups at the school. Temple Graduate School Cost of Attendance

$32,420 Avg Tuition & Fees (In-State)
$26,252 Median Graduate Debt

The average graduate full-time tuition and fees is shown in the table below.

In-State Out-of-State
Tuition $31,334 $47,568
Fees $1,086 $1,086

Temple Graduate Student Debt

The typical graduate student at Temple who borrowed carries a median debt of $26,252.

Average Salary of Temple Graduate Programs

$84,803 Avg Masters Early-Career Salary
$90,614 Avg Doctorate Early-Career Salary
$133,269 Avg Professional Degree Early-Career Salary
$65,871 Avg Post-Masters Certificate Early-Career Salary

Master’s Degree Average Earnings

Master’s degree recipients from Temple earn an average early-career salary of $84,803.

Doctorate Degree Average Earnings

Graduate students who earn their doctoral degree at Temple enter the workforce with an average early-career salary of $90,614.

Professional Degree Average Earnings

Graduate students who earn their professional degree at Temple enter the workforce with an average early-career salary of $133,269.

Post-Master’s Certificate Average Earnings

Graduate students who earn their post-master’s certificate at Temple enter the workforce with an average early-career salary of $65,871.

Early-career pay varies by field of study. The following table shows the graduate fields of study at Temple with the highest average early-career salaries for recent graduates.

Graduate Field of Study Avg Early-Career Salary
Dentistry $164,874
Business Administration & Management $138,380
Pharmacy/Pharmaceutical Sciences $137,239
Medicine $136,928
Nursing $132,363
Finance & Financial Management $128,328
Legal Research $121,289
Accounting $118,242
Information Technology $115,503
Law $107,536

Online Learning for Temple Grad Students

32.3% Took At Least One Online Class
17.8% Took All Classes Online

32.3% of the graduate students at Temple took at least one online course.For that same period, 17.8% of grad students took all of their classes online. Online Learning at Temple University
